Expanding the scientist's palette: factors ofengagement with the Arts in geosciences and biology research

Barthélemy Chollet and Karine Revet

Technovation, 2025, vol. 146, issue C

Abstract: Artistic work can offer powerful ways to enhance the societal impact and dissemination of scientific research. The practice of engaging with the Arts, however, is still far from widespread among scientists. In this study, we examine the factors that increase the likelihood that a principal investigator (PI) integrates some engagement with the Arts in the design of a research project. We draw on a database of 31,859 NSF standard grants (2003–2023) in geosciences and biology. Through a search for a set of keywords in project descriptions, we identify the rare projects that engage with the Arts. We find that projects designed by female scientists, in universities of lower research intensity, are most likely to engage with the Arts. Moreover, occurrences of this practice vary considerably across scientific subdomains. Additionally, addressing a sustainable development goal may either increase or decrease the likelihood that a project engages with the Arts, depending on the specific goal at hand.
